Output 8c74dbdea2f1ffc83d17e3313952bcaa43eaa230ee48d1a6a4103aaedabe7eab:0

value
176695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6b77ff4514fe05e3865c68838db93fb8c07500 OP_EQUAL
address
3HbGEyrmiKNsL7F1cnk1CsrgTgzDGgJHnt
transaction
8c74dbdea2f1ffc83d17e3313952bcaa43eaa230ee48d1a6a4103aaedabe7eab
confirmations
54863
spent
true